## 5.1.0 — Dependency pinning defaults changed

For the weekly sync: Quillstack's build tooling now pins all transitive dependencies by default, not just direct ones. Previously, floor versions were allowed for transitives, which caused the reproducibility gap Tomas flagged two sprints ago. Teams can opt out per-package via an allowlist, but the policy check in CI will flag any unpinned entry starting next cycle. The pinning resolver reads its behavior from the shared policy config, whose new defaults are shown below.

deployment values, yahag-tawef:
ZORWYN_HOST=zorwyn.tolvaqlabs.internal
ZORWYN_PORT=9300

## Ownership

The Tallyhawk billing worker uses blue-green deploys managed by the Switchyard pipeline. Green receives traffic only after the invoice-replay check passes; rollbacks flip the router, never redeploy. Do not deploy during the nightly settlement window. Config lives in deploy/switchyard.toml. Questions about the deploy process, cutover approvals, or emergency rollbacks should go to the current owner, whose name appears below.

account owner for kafop-haweg: Pelax Gilael Istir

Handover — PickPath Optimizer (Skellen warehouse)

Handing this to you carefully: the pick-list optimizer has been recalculating routes twice per batch since Tuesday's deploy. I've pinned the route cache and disabled the experimental zoning heuristic; throughput is stable but watch queue depth overnight. The optimizer is currently running with the following configuration values.

settings of tagef-bawif:
DRUIX_HOST=druix.zemvarlabs.internal
DRUIX_PORT=8000